Understanding Exporting
Exporting involves selling goods or services to customers in foreign markets. By venturing into international sales, you can access a broader customer base, increase revenue, and reduce dependence on local markets.
The Advantages of Exporting for Wholesale Businesses
One of the most compelling reasons to consider exporting is the access it provides to larger markets. This access can significantly boost your sales volume. Moreover, entering foreign markets can help mitigate risks associated with local economic downturns.
Building a Global Brand
Exporting enables you to establish a global brand presence. When your products are available worldwide, your brand reputation can grow, leading to increased customer trust and loyalty.
Strategies for Successful Exporting
To succeed in exporting, businesses must adopt comprehensive strategies. Conducting market research to understand foreign buyers’ needs and preferences is essential. Partnering with experienced export agents or attending trade shows can also provide invaluable insights.
Trade Agreements and Regulations
Understanding international trade agreements and regulations is crucial for seamless exporting. Compliance with export laws helps avoid penalties and facilitates smoother transactions.
